My 2009 Hhr has what is referred to as the may 15, 2014 gm tail light malfunction. The malfunction is caused from faulty wiring and causes the brake lights illuminate without touching the brake pedal and they remain on while driving. This malfunction also disables safety features like electronic stability control ¿ which tries to correct for skids ¿ and panic braking assist, which is designed to make sure the vehicle¿s full braking power is being used in an emergency. It also disables the cruise control and the traction control. In 2014 g. M. Said it knew of hundreds of complaints and 13 accidents associated with the problem. I have had several near accidents and several issues of road rage from other drivers since my Hhr began the malfunctioning in February 2014 which is when I first contacted gm to get it fixed. Since then I have filed complaints with the NHTSA, the federal trade commission, the state of wisconsin consumer protection agency and gm but have not yet had anyone step up and fix the problem. Since the malfunction causes the bcm to lose memory with the brake positioning sensor I did take the vehicle to a certified gm dealership and had them re-learn the memory between the two. This solved the problem temporarily and lasted about two months. I cannot afford to have this done every two month as a solution.
